SEMICON India 2026 records 25 key tie-ups across semiconductor value chain

New Delhi, Sep 18 (IANS) Day 2 of SEMICON India 2026 witnessed 25 key announcements and collaborations covering various segments of the semiconductor value chain, including semiconductor manufacturing, materials, logistics, chip design, advanced packaging, power electronics and workforce development, according to a statement issued by the Ministry of Electronics and IT on Friday.
India’s Tata Electronics and L&T Semiconductor Technologies signed MoUs and partnership agreements with various overseas technology companies aimed at strengthening India’s semiconductor ecosystem, spanning supply chain localisation, advanced packaging, skilling, and deep-tech investment.
Tata Electronics signed agreements with INOX Air Products Ltd for collaboration to strengthen the local supply chain for high-purity gases critical to semiconductor manufacturing. The company also announced a partnership with Sumitomo Chemical Ltd to localise production of high-purity wet chemicals and advanced materials for front-end semiconductor manufacturing.
Tata Electronics & Kelington Engineering Pte Ltd agreed on a collaboration to accelerate fab readiness via gas distribution systems, high-purity piping, and process tool hook-up. The collaboration includes training local partners in specialised semiconductor manufacturing skills.
Tata Electronics & Enomoto Co. Ltd have formed a partnership to strengthen advanced semiconductor packaging capabilities through joint R&D and localisation of Lead-frame manufacturing.
C-MET, Pune & Hindalco Industries Limited signed an MoU to scale up critical raw materials essential to the semiconductor ecosystem, strengthening indigenous material capabilities and supply chain resilience.
MeitY, Ministry of Power & POWERGRID: Collaboration to support indigenisation of Silicon Carbide Power Modules for Voltage Source Converter (VSC) based HVDC transmission systems, to be piloted at POWERGRID’s 1,000 MW Pusauli project, Bihar.
L&T Semiconductor Technologies Ltd & Virtual Forest Pvt Ltd have reached an agreement on co-development of power electronics solutions for air conditioning and solar-powered systems. The Indian company has also forged a partnership with Newen Systems Pvt Ltd for the development of Silicon Carbide Power Modules for next-gen renewable energy systems and AI data centres.
L&T Semiconductor Technologies Ltd & Fimer India Pvt Ltd: Development of Insulated Gate Bipolar Transistors for renewable energy systems.
India Deep Tech Alliance reported investments of $263 million across 56 Indian deep-tech companies.
The event received an encouraging response, with nearly 12,000 visitors on the first day, most of whom were industry participants, and featured more than 600 exhibitors, including around 300 international exhibitors.
Addressing the media, Minister of Electronics and IT Ashwini Vaishnaw said participation was even higher on the second day, with strong business-to-business engagement, several agreements being concluded during business meetings and a good response to sessions. Country roundtables also received a positive response, with more than 30 companies each from Japan and Singapore participating in their respective pavilions, alongside participation from South Korea and several European countries, including Belgium, the Netherlands and Sweden.
He said the growing participation reflected increasing global interest in expanding semiconductor-related activities in India, with industry leaders indicating their willingness to scale up investment based on their execution ability.
The minister highlighted the MoU between India Semiconductor Mission and Nippon Express, under which the company will provide expertise in logistics, warehousing, customs and related supply-chain requirements as India’s semiconductor ecosystem expands.
He also underlined opportunities for Indian entrepreneurs and emphasised that semiconductor companies must compete globally on cost and quality, while taking into account manufacturability, product life cycle and power consumption.
On sustainability, the minister highlighted the use of extensive water recycling in semiconductor fabs and closed-loop cooling systems in data centres, underlining the importance of resource-efficient technologies as these sectors expand.
